Description:

The City of Hays, Kansas is inviting sealed bids for one (1) new 41" tall X 7'3" wide double-sided Full Color LED message center for existing Hays Convention & Visitors Bureau sign. this shall also include two (2) new circle logo panels and four (4) new identification panels. All labor and materials are to be included as well as disposal of existing message center and sign panels. The sign is to be installed, and support and service received throughout the warranty period by the awarded company. Bids will be opened at 3:00 p.m. on May 13, 2025, in the City Commission Chambers.
